Author vstinner
Recipients serhiy.storchaka, sfreilich, vstinner
Date 2019-01-11.10:42:12
SpamBayes Score -1.0
Marked as misclassified Yes
Message-id <1547203332.41.0.527887569757.issue35711@roundup.psfhosted.org>
In-reply-to
Content
I'm a supporter to add *more* checks to the debug build but also provide a Python runtime compiled in debug mode which would be ABI compatible (no need to rebuild C extensions).

See my large project:

   https://pythoncapi.readthedocs.io/

Especially:

   https://pythoncapi.readthedocs.io/runtimes.html#debug-build

It would avoid any overhead at runtime for the regular runtime (compiled in release mode).

Only we would have such "debug runtime" available, I even plan to remove runtime checks from the release build :-)

https://pythoncapi.readthedocs.io/optimization_ideas.html#remove-debug-checks
History
Date User Action Args
2019-01-11 10:42:14vstinnersetrecipients: + vstinner, serhiy.storchaka, sfreilich
2019-01-11 10:42:12vstinnersetmessageid: <1547203332.41.0.527887569757.issue35711@roundup.psfhosted.org>
2019-01-11 10:42:12vstinnerlinkissue35711 messages
2019-01-11 10:42:12vstinnercreate